They provide excellent sound insulation
uPVC is soundproof because of its strength and rigidity. A tight sealant is also placed around the frame to limit the amount of air that could get into your home. uPVC windows also come with multi-chamber profiles that reduce outside noise to help you sleep more peacefully. You can also get uPVC windows with laminated glass, which improves noise reduction and security.

They are affordable
Upvc windows are cost-effective and can be installed quickly. They are also strong and durable, as well as efficient. They are a great option for any home, and come in a variety of sizes styles, styles and colors. They are popular with homeowners, builders and designers for their flexibility. Upvc windows are simple to maintain and can be utilized everywhere in the house.
UPVC window pricing can vary depending on the frame style and the type of glazing as well as labour costs in your area. Installing larger UPVC windows, for instance they can be more expensive. In addition the custom or unique UPVC windows may also be more expensive. It is essential to compare prices and research to ensure that you are getting the most value for your money.
Another factor that influences UPVC window prices is the quality of the UPVC material. Different manufacturers employ different materials, and some might be more durable than others. The better the quality, the better UPVC will perform. This is particularly important for those who live in an area that has extreme weather conditions.
A quality UPVC will last between 20 to 50 years. However, the life expectancy of UPVC is dependent on the quality of the hardware and the glass doctor. If you have UPVC windows with double or triple glazing doctor they will last longer than windows made of single-glazed glass.
